The cheapest way to get from San Francisco to Preservation Park is to drive which costs $1 - $3 and takes 15 min.
The fastest way to get from San Francisco to Preservation Park is to taxi which takes 15 min and costs $60 - $75.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Market St & South Van Ness Av and arriving at 14th St & Clay St. Services depart every two hours,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 34 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Civic Center / UN Plaza and arriving at 12th Street / Oakland City Center. Services depart every 10 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 16 min.
The distance between San Francisco and Preservation Park is 9 miles. The road distance is 10.6 miles.
The best way to get from San Francisco to Preservation Park without a car is to BART which takes 23 min and costs $2 - $4.
The BART from Civic Center / UN Plaza to 12th Street / Oakland City Center takes 16 min including transfers and departs every 10 minutes.
